Josep Lluis Mateo

Josep Lluís Mateo ( born April 23, 1949 in Barcelona ) is a Spanish architect.

Biography

Mateo works as an architect since 1974, having previously studied architecture at the Escola Tecnica Superior d' Arquitectura ( ETSAB ) in Barcelona.

From 1981 to 1990 he was director of the journal " Quaderns d' Arquitectura i Urbanisme ", which in this period with the ACCA Award, the LAUS price, Ciutat de Barcelona Prize and of the International Union of Architects (UIA ) was excellent.

In 1991, he founded the company " MAP Architects" in Barcelona and heads the architectural practice since 1995, together with Marta Cervello. "MAP Architects" employs about 40 architects. Among other things, planned the branch of the country's Central Bank Deutsche Bundesbank in Chemnitz, the International Convention Center in Barcelona, various tourism and office complexes in Locarno- Ascona, an office block in Euro Lille, the Auditorium and Museum of Contemporary Art in Castelo Branco, the new Government headquarters in Haarlem, and also amusement parks in Hangzhou and Qingpu.

Since 1994, Mateo holds a Ph.D. Universitat Politècnica de Catalunya was, from 1996 to 2002 professor at the ETSAB and taught the way at various universities, including the State Academy of Fine Arts in Stuttgart, the Swiss Federal Institute of Technology Zurich ( ETH), the Unité Pedagogique 8 ( UP8 ) in Paris Belville, the Oslo Amatørastronomers Forening ( OAF ), the Berlage Institute in Rotterdam and the Getty Center in Los Angeles. Since 2002 he has been Professor of Architecture and Design at the ETH in Zurich.

Awards

For his work he has received several international awards, including 1991 with the Italstat prize for young European architects and in the same year at the Biennial in Santander for the transformation of the heart of Ullastret, 1993 for the central building of the sports division of the Universitat Autònoma de Barcelona the FAD prize, which has been repeatedly awarded him in 2000 for a social housing project in El Prat de Llobregat.
